Gulf of Georgia Cannery
Museum
The Gulf of Georgia Cannery is a National Historic Site of Canada located in Steveston village in Richmond, British Columbia. Built in 1894, the cannery echoes the days when it was the leading producer of canned salmon in British Columbia. Gulf of Georgia Cannery is situated 130 metres northwest of Diamond Parking.

Steveston Tram Museum
Museum
The Steveston Tram Museum is a rail museum in Steveston, BC. The museum houses one of seven remaining interurban streetcars that previously operated as part of the British Columbia Electric Railway. Steveston Tram Museum is situated 380 metres northeast of Diamond Parking.

Steveston
Suburb
The settlement of Steveston, founded in the 1880s, is a neighbourhood of Richmond in Metro Vancouver. On the southwest tip of Lulu Island, the village is a historic port and salmon canning centre at the mouth of the South Arm of the Fraser River.
Seafair
Suburb
Seafair is a neighbourhood in Richmond, British Columbia, Canada. It occupies the western edge of Lulu Island along the Strait of Georgia. The residential community is bounded by Granville Avenue to the north, Railway Avenue to the east, Williams Road to the south, and the West Dyke Trail to the west.
